    About 3/4 of this thread is about the wrong speed thing.
    If you don't want to read it the summary is that the ProjeKct X bonus album on the DVD plays about 15% faster than it should.

    The downloads are still on DGM Live. If you try to buy them, it refunds you – so the only way to access them is to contact DGM with proof of box purchase.

    Seems silly they haven't put these up for individual download sales yet, as an aside.
